What is Laravel
• Laravel is open-source PHP framework.
• Laravel is tool for developing web application using concept of model-view-control (MVC)
• Laravel developed by Taylor Orwell by first release June 2011.

Laravel directories
./app/ # Your Laravel application ./app/commands/ # - Command line scripts ./app/config/ # - Configuration files ./app/controllers/ # - Controllers ./app/database/ # - Database migrations and seeders ./app/lang/ # - Localization variables ./app/models/ # - Classes used to represent entities ./app/start/ # - Startup scripts ./app/storage/ # - Cache and logs directory ./app/tests/ # - Test cases ./app/views/ # - Templates that are rendered to HTML ./app/filters.php # - Filters executed before/after a request ./app/routes.php # - URLs and actions

1. Create Home
• Open route.php in directory root\larvel\app\
• Add code below
Route::get('/home', function()
{
echo "hello world";
exit;
});

3.Create contents
• Create a file “home.blade.php” place at \root\laravel\app\views
• Type code below
@extends('master')
@section('content')
<div class = "well">
This is Home zone
</div>
@stop

5. Create two contents
• Copy “home.blade.php” and past with change filename to be “content1.blade.php” and “content2.blade.php”
• Give some contents in the files
@extends('master')
@section('content')
<div class = "well">
This is content2
</div>
@stop
• Add new route
Route::get('/c1', function()
{
return View::make('content1');
});
Route::get('/c2', function()
{
return View::make('content2');
});
